一、缓存预热为什么要进行缓存预热? 缓存预热就是系统启动前,提前将相关的缓存数据直接加载到缓存系统。避免在用户请求的时候,先查询数据库,然后再将数据缓存的问题!用户直接查询事先被预热的缓存数据!怎么做?前置准备工作: 日常例行统计数据访问记录,统计访问频度较高的热点数据 利用LRU数据删除策略,构建数据留存队列 例如:storm与kafka配合准备工作: 将统计结果中的数据分类,根据级别,redi
转载
2024-03-23 12:41:04
35阅读
# 学习 MySQL 预处理语句(PREPARE)
在数据库编程中,预处理语句是一种非常重要的技巧,它能够提高查询的性能和安全性。MySQL 的预处理语句,使得我们可以在数据库中预编译 SQL 语句,然后再多次执行它。对于刚入行的小白来说,理解并掌握这一点尤为重要。本文将详细介绍如何实现 MySQL 的预处理语句,并通过步骤一一解释。
## 过程概述
以下是实现 MySQL 预处理语句的基本
lua连接数据库不只luasql这个库,但目前更新最快的的貌似是这个luasql,他是开源的,支持的数据库功能如下:Connect to ODBC, ADO, Oracle, MySQL, SQLite and PostgreSQL databases;Execute arbitrary SQL statements;Retrieve results in a row-by-row cursor fashion.源码直接编译就得到一个dll,这个dll可以被c++或lua引用1.首先下载luasql源代码://.keplerproject.org/luasql/index.htm
转载
2013-07-07 03:42:00
186阅读
2评论
噪声、缺失值和不一致数据的侵扰,因为数据库太大(常常多达数兆兆字节,甚至更多)。“如何对数据进行预处理,提高数据质量,从而提高挖掘结果的质量? 如何对数据预处理,使得挖掘过程更加有效、更加容易?”数据清理可以清除数据中的噪声,纠正不一致。数据集成将数据由多个数据源合并成一致的数据存储,如数据仓库。数据归约可以通过如聚集、删除冗余特征或聚类来降低数据的规模。数据变换(例如,规范化)可以用来把数据压缩
转载
2024-08-26 21:02:43
41阅读
# Java数据库预处理技术
## 简介
在Java中,与数据库进行交互是非常常见的操作,可以通过预处理技术来提高数据库操作的效率和安全性。Java数据库预处理技术是一种将SQL语句和Java代码分离的方法,可以有效地防止SQL注入攻击,并提高数据库操作的性能。
## 什么是预处理
预处理是将SQL语句与参数分开,在执行SQL语句之前,先将SQL语句发送到数据库服务器进行编译。这样做的好处是可
原创
2023-08-07 17:32:56
56阅读
一.介绍预处理的意思是先提交sql语句到mysql服务端,执行预编译,客户端执行sql语句时,只需上传输入参数即可。从 5.1开始,mysql支持服务器端的Prepared Statements,他使用在client/server更有优势的binary protocol。(mysql的传统的协议中,在把数据通过网络传输前,需要把一切数据都转换成strings,这样就比
转载
精选
2013-06-03 17:30:50
10000+阅读
预处理语句对于防止 MySQL 注入是非常有用的。 预处理语句及绑定参数 预处理语句用于执行多个相同的 SQL 语句,并且执行效率更高。 预处理语句的工作原理如下: 预处理:创建 SQL 语句模板并发送到数据库。预留的值使用参数 "?" 标记 。例如: INSERT INTO MyGuests (firstname, lastname, email) VALUES(?, ?, ?)
转载
2024-02-04 00:00:53
54阅读
数据预处理为什么要进行预处理现实世界的数据很“脏”不完整的: 缺少属性值, 感兴趣的属性缺少属性值, 或仅包含聚集数据 如, occupation=“ ” 来源于:收集数据时,在不同的阶段具有不同的考虑;人/硬件/软件的问题等。含噪声的: 包含错误或存在孤立点 如, Salary=“-10” 来源于:收集阶段;数据传输阶段等。不一致的: 在名称或代码之间存在着差异 如, Age=“42” Birt
转载
2023-12-24 09:45:55
100阅读
# MySQL 数据库预处理技术入门指南
在软件开发中,我们常常需要与数据库进行交互。为此,我们需要使用 "预处理技术" 来提高数据库操作的安全性、性能和可维护性。本文将带你一步步了解如何在 MySQL 中使用预处理语句。
## 流程概述
以下是实现 MySQL 数据库预处理技术的基本步骤:
| 步骤 | 描述
原创
2024-09-21 07:21:18
117阅读
1.8 预处理每个代码的段的执行都要经历:词法分析——语法分析——
原创
2022-03-07 11:06:43
152阅读
# MySQL数据库SQL预处理指南
在现代软件开发中,数据库成为了应用程序的核心部分。为了安全地与数据库进行交互,我们需要使用SQL预处理(Prepared Statements)。这能够有效防止SQL注入等常见安全问题,提升应用的整体安全性和性能。本文将为你介绍如何在MySQL中实现SQL预处理的完整流程。
## 流程概览
在讲解每个步骤之前,首先看看整体流程:
| 步骤 | 描述
本文主要是对数据库方面进行案例复习,共包含两版,这是第二版,对数据库不是很理解的同学可以看看,最好自己试着敲一遍,一定会有帮助的。数据库版(二)为了复习和巩固前面所学习的知识,我做了这个练习,遇到了问题,加深了自己的一些理解。 需求:设置一个学生管理系统1.添加学生信息 2.显示学生信息 3.删除学生信息 4.修改学生信息 5.查看学生信息 6.排序 7.退出数据库连接池版工具类c3p0 (了解即
1.8 预处理每个代码的段的执行都要经历:词法分析——语法分析——编译——执行预编译一次,可以多次执行。用来解决一条SQL语句频繁执行的问题。预处理语句:prepare 预处理名字 from ‘sql语句’执行预处理:execute 预处理名字 [using 变量]例题:不带参数的预处理-- 创建预处理mysql> prepare stmt from 'select * f...
原创
2021-08-17 16:58:38
118阅读
使用 PREPARE 语句可在运行时解析、验证和生成一个或多个 SQL 语句的执行计划;用法请在 ESQL/C 或 SPL 例程中使用此语句。PREPARE 语句启用您的程序来在运行时收集一个(或对于 ESQL/C,多于一个)SQL 语句的文本,来声明结果的准备好的对象的标识符,并使之可运行。以三个步骤实现此 SQL 的动态形式:PREPARE 语句接收语句文本为输入,或作为引用的字符串,或 ES
转载
2024-04-22 09:15:16
201阅读
[TOC]Lua数据库访问(普通方式)为lua安装数据库扩展主要是利用Lua的包管理工具LuaRocksLuaRocks中有众多的lua包 包括但不限于 json, base64, md5, socke, 各种无数据,之类的具体可以来这里看https://luarocks.org注意事项5.2 版本之后的require 不再定义全局变量,需要保存其返回值。
`require "luasql.mys
转载
2024-04-21 23:12:37
61阅读
预处理语句允许你先定义一个SQL模板,并且之后可以用不同的参数多次执行这个模板,而不需要每次执行时都解析和编译SQL语句。这样可以减少解析时间,提高执行效率,同时也增强了安全性,特别是对于包含用户输入的查询。
原创
2024-05-27 14:48:01
417阅读
http://dev.mysql.com/doc/refman/5.1/en/sql-syntax-prepared-statements.html
一:介绍
从 5.1开始,mysql支持服务器端的Prepared Statements,他使用在client/server更有优势的binary protocol,(mysql的传统的协议中,再把数
一:为什么要预处理数据?(1)现实世界的数据是肮脏的(不完整,含噪声,不一致)(2)没有高质量的数据,就没有高质量的挖掘结果(高质量的决策必须依赖于高质量的数据;数据仓库需要对高质量的数据进行一致地集成)(3)原始数据中存在的问题:不一致 —— 数据内含出现不一致情况重复不完整 —— 感兴趣的属性没有含噪声 —— 数据中存在着错误、或异常(偏离期望值)的数据高维度二:数据预处理的方法(1)数据清洗
转载
2023-07-25 23:35:51
75阅读
数据库,顾名思义就是存储数据的仓库。目前常用的数据库如Oracle、Sybase等各有其千秋,但是如果挑出一款最为流行的数据库软件,非MySql莫属。SQL,Structured Query Language结构化查询语言,是MySql的使用语言,也是我们在MySql数据库中对数据进行数据操作、查询、修改等操作的工具。创建数据库一列数据是一个字段,多个字段构成数据表,而数据库就是大量带
转载
2024-04-06 08:52:35
77阅读
第2章 数据预处理
Ø 有大量数据预处理技术。
数据清理可以去掉数据中的噪音,纠正不一致。
数据集成将数据由多个源合并成一致的数据存储,如数据仓库。
数据变换(如规范化)也可以使用。例如,规范化可以改进涉及距离度量的挖掘算法的精度和有效性。
数据归约可以通过聚集、删除冗余特征或聚类等
转载
2023-11-13 22:23:16
48阅读